Vehicle Storage
If you're not going to drive you vehicle for 25 days
or more, remove the black, negative (-) cable
from the battery. This will help keep your battery
from running down.
To be sure the vent hose (A) is properly attached, the
vent hose connectors (B) must be securely reattached to
the vent outlets (C) on each side of the battery, and
the vent assembly grommet
(D)
must be secured to the
floor pan (E).
Batteries have acid that can burn you and gas
that can explode. You can be badly hurt if you
aren't careful. See "Jump Starting" next for
tips on working around a battery without
getting hurt.
Contact your dealer to learn how to prepare your
vehicle for longer storage periods.
